IXTH14N80

IXTH14N80

Product Overview

Category: Power MOSFET
Use: Switching applications in power supplies, motor control, and other high voltage applications
Characteristics: High voltage capability, low on-resistance, fast switching speed
Package: TO-247
Essence: Power MOSFET for high voltage applications
Packaging/Quantity: Typically sold in reels of 50 or 100 units

Specifications

  • Voltage Rating: 800V
  • Current Rating: 14A
  • On-Resistance: 0.45Ω
  • Gate Threshold Voltage: 2.5V
  • Gate Charge: 40nC
  • Operating Temperature Range: -55°C to 150°C

Detailed Pin Configuration

The IXTH14N80 follows the standard pin configuration for a TO-247 package: 1. Gate (G) 2. Drain (D) 3. Source (S)

Working Principles

The IXTH14N80 operates based on the principles of field-effect transistors, utilizing the gate voltage to control the flow of current between the drain and source terminals. When a sufficient gate voltage is applied, the MOSFET conducts, allowing current to flow through it.
